I think one key (non-musical) difference between house and trance, is that fans of the type of house we went to see (deep house? authentic house lol) do tend remain in the scene as they get older (look at Ohm and myself as an example). But I see trance as more of a young person's game only.
Of course, house in the US was never as much about E as it was in Europe. Its much more underground and ethnic in the US, which is why the scene is quite strong there. And here I am happy to report
